Endoscopic ventriculostomy is a specialized surgical procedure primarily used to treat conditions associated with obstructive hydrocephalus, a condition characterized by the accumulation of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) within the ventricles of the brain due to blockage in normal CSF flow pathways. The procedure involves the use of an endoscope, a thin, flexible tube equipped with a camera and surgical instruments, which allows neurosurgeons to access the brain's ventricular system through small incisions. This minimally invasive technique offers several advantages over traditional open surgery, such as reduced recovery time, less postoperative pain, and lower risk of complications. During the procedure, the surgeon navigates the endoscope through the brain's natural anatomical corridors, usually targeting the third ventricle or the foramen of Monro. Once access is gained, a small hole is created in the floor of the ventricle, allowing the excess CSF to drain into surrounding brain tissue, thereby bypassing the obstructed pathways. The creation of this opening is essential, as it alleviates the pressure caused by the buildup of fluid, restoring normal CSF circulation. The success of endoscopic ventriculostomy relies heavily on the precise identification of the anatomical landmarks within the ventricle and the skill of the surgeon. Patients typically experience significant symptom relief following the procedure, with many reporting improvements in headaches, balance, and cognitive function. The indication for endoscopic ventriculostomy may include congenital anomalies, tumors, or post-infectious causes of hydrocephalus. The procedure is particularly valuable in pediatric patients, where traditional shunting methods may be associated with higher rates of complications and failure. Postoperative assessments usually involve monitoring neurological status, conducting imaging studies, and evaluating CSF dynamics to ensure that the newly created pathway remains patent. Long-term outcomes for patients undergoing endoscopic ventriculostomy are generally favorable, with many achieving sustained resolution of hydrocephalus symptoms without the need for additional surgical interventions. It is essential for patients to be appropriately selected for this procedure, as anatomical variations in the ventricular system can influence the likelihood of success. In cases where endoscopic ventriculostomy is unsuccessful or not feasible, alternative treatments, such as ventriculoperitoneal shunting, may be considered.
